
软件测试
文章平均质量分 83
阿里自动化测试君
这个作者很懒,什么都没留下…
展开
-
费劲心思才弄来的python自动化测试面试题
断言Assert用于在代码中验证实际结果是不是符合预期结果,如果测试用例执行失败会抛出异常并提供断言日志Web自动化测试是从UI (用户界面)层面进行的自动化测试,测试人员通过编程自动化程序(测试用例脚本)来打开浏览器测试网站的业务逻辑。Selenium是一个开源的web自动化测试框架,支持多种编程语言开发自动化测试脚本,支持跨浏览器平台进行测试我还给大家准备了一些福利,有需要的可以私信关键字“资料”获取哟。项目实战app项目,银行项目,医药项目,电商,金融大型电商项目。原创 2022-10-08 19:25:27 · 426 阅读 · 0 评论 -
面试题:支付功能怎么测试?如何回答?
九月了,有很多的小伙伴已经全面武装好准备找工作了,九月和十月是黄金期——俗称”金九银十“。那么,作为测试,不管是面试还是笔试,必然要被考验到的就是”测试思维“。在面试中就是体现在如下面试题中:“说说你项目中的xx模块你是如何测试的?”“给你一个购物车,你要怎么测试?”"你说一下这个产品的登录功能有哪些测试点?"“支付功能怎么测试?”......所有的这些问题其实都是在考察你的测试思维。我们再回答这类问题的时候有方法可依循的。那么今天这篇文章,笔者来和大家分析一个问题这个问题就是以原创 2022-09-15 21:38:59 · 2058 阅读 · 0 评论 -
测试员在面试中被问到 “你对加班的看法” 该如何回答?
最后,我们来总结一下,回答这个问题,需要提前做好针对特定公司的功课,确保不要给面试官一种安于现状、消极怠工的状态,也不需要把自己的位置放的“过低”,完全无底线的迎合公司加班的意愿,能够恰如其分的传达对加班的正确态度就可以了。那么,关于加班,各位小可爱有什么看法呢?欢迎留言评论。原创 2022-09-14 21:54:59 · 833 阅读 · 0 评论 -
没有五十瓶红牛我是不会告诉你——面试中应该如何正确谈薪
金九银十已经来临,很多小伙伴已经开始投身跳槽的准备中了。大家选择跳槽无非是想增加自己的工资收入,所以面试过程中的谈薪环节就显得尤为重要,谈的好与不好,未来整个的薪资水平都可能受影响。那面试中,当问到“你的期望薪资是多少?“应该如何回答呢? 作为一名资深的软件测试人员,笔者总结了n次跳槽经验想给大家分享一下,从以下3个方面聊一聊:了解市场薪资行情清楚薪酬结构面试如何谈薪原创 2022-09-04 21:19:54 · 330 阅读 · 2 评论 -
2022强推的—神级面试文档、文档在手面试无忧
在这个鸟语花香,阳光正好的季节,笔者找到了一份神级面试文档,用了这个文档,再也不用害怕面试官了,笔者在这里就不多说废话了。直接进入主题吧。测试类型有:功能测试,性能测试,界面测试。功能测试在测试工作中占的比例最大,功能测试也叫黑盒测试。是把测试对象看作一个黑盒子。利用黑盒测试法进行动态测试时,需要测试软件产品的功能,不需测试软件产品的内部结构和处理过程。采用黑盒技术设计测试用例的方法有:等价类划分、边界值分析、错误推测、因果图和综合策略。性能测试是通过自动化的测试工具模拟多种正常、峰值以及异常负载条件来原创 2022-06-07 21:43:02 · 134 阅读 · 0 评论 -
Python自动化测试之文件基础操作
今天笔者想和大家聊聊python的基础,主要讲解Python中的文件基础操作等内容,是文件操作的基础讲解,在后续的自动化测试中会需要使用到,所以有兴趣的可以跟着我一起学习下去哟。 2.1 open函数讲解2.1.1 open函数创建open函数主要用于打开一个文件,创建一个file的对象,最基础的用法如下代码所示:2.1.2 读取文件所有(read)往往我们要打开一个文件,都是要获取文件中的数据使用或阅读,我们可以通过open函数中的read方式来读取文件,读取出的文件类型为字符串类型:在文件为原创 2022-06-02 22:01:36 · 285 阅读 · 2 评论 -
腾讯测试岗位的面试题合集,请查收
今天呢,笔者要给大家送来一份面经,这份面经呢是腾讯测试岗位的面试题合集,废话不多说我们直接看看随着软件文档系统日益庞大,文档测试已经成为软件测试的重要内容。文档测试对象主要如下:包装文字和图形;市场宣传材料、广告以及其它插页;授权、注册登记表;最终用户许可协议;安装和设置向导;用户手册;联机帮助;样例、示范例子和模板;文档测试的目的是提高易用性和可靠性,降低支持费用,因为用户通过文档就可以自己解决问题。因文档测试的检查内容主要如下:读者对象——主要是文档的内容是否能让该级别的读者理解;术语——主要是检查术语原创 2022-06-01 22:11:56 · 2154 阅读 · 0 评论 -
bug的处理流程是什么?一文教你快速学会bug的处理流程
前言笔者今天想和大家来聊聊bug的处理流程,咱们不谈工具,单把它本质的一些东西抽离出来与大家分享,废话不多说我们直接进入主题吧。一、Bug的属性1、Bug重现环境这个应该是我们重现bug的一个前提,如果没有这个前提,我们可能会无法重现问题,或者跟本就无从下手。2、操作系统这个是一般软件运行的一大前提,基本上所有的软件都依赖于操作系统之上的,对于一个软件来说,要想在某个操作系统上运行,必须要对这个操作系统支持,这就需要有真对性的设计与开发。对于不同的操作系统,其可能存在差异(.原创 2022-05-26 22:03:18 · 2741 阅读 · 0 评论 -
测试用例是什么?怎么写?不会测试用例的看过来,三分钟教会你
前言今天笔者想和大家来聊聊测试用例,这篇文章主要是想要写给测试小伙伴们的,因为我发现还是有很多小伙伴在遇到写测试用例的时候无从下手,我就想和大家简单的聊聊,这篇文章主要是针对功能测试的哟。在这篇文章的后面笔者给大家准备一份惊喜哟一、什么是测试用例?测试用例是为某个特殊目标而编制的一组测试输入、执行条件以及预期结果,以便测试某个程序路径或核实是否满足某个特定需求。通俗的讲:就是把我们测试系统的操作步骤按照一定的格式用文字描述出来。二、写测试用例有什么好处?1、理清思路,避原创 2022-05-26 20:32:37 · 35754 阅读 · 0 评论 -
阿里高p强推,每个测试人都该来看看的接口自动化神级资料
前言看过我的文章的小伙伴们都知道,我的文章或多或少都有涉及到接口,那么今天呢,我想用一篇文章详细的给小伙伴们来介绍一下接口,我分别会从接口的概念和接口测试这两个方面来介绍,这里呢我就不多说废话了,咱们直接进入正题吧。一、接口的概念接口又称API(Application Programming Interface,应用程序编程接口),是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件得以访问一组例程的能力,而又无需访问源码,或理解内部工作机制的细节。1.1简单概括为以下3点:原创 2022-05-24 21:12:21 · 172 阅读 · 0 评论 -
简述UI自动化测试Selenium
UI自动化测试Selenium是非常优秀的WEB(UI)自动化测试框架最新的版本是Selenium4.x。Selenium支持主流的浏览器自动化测试,具体是Chrome,IE,Firefox等浏览器Selenium也是支持主流的开发语言,如Python,Java,Net,PHPSelenium IDESelenium 1.0WebDriverSelenium=WevbDriver+Selenium搭建:1、安装Selenium的库,pip3 install selen原创 2022-05-12 22:21:14 · 511 阅读 · 0 评论 -
2022-软件测试工程师面试题(自我总结)
bug的定义,bug的周期软件bug是指软件程序的漏洞和缺陷,测试工程师或用户所发现和提出的软件可改进的细节、或与需求文档存在差异的功能实现等 生命周期中缺陷状态:新建-->指派-->已解决-->待验-->关闭 发现BUG-->提交BUG-->指派BUG-->研发确认BUG-->研发去修复BUG-->回归验证BUG-->是否通过验证-->关闭BUG 2. 怎么判断是前端bug还是后端bug界面相关,排版错乱,文案错误等问题都属于原创 2022-05-11 22:07:22 · 360 阅读 · 0 评论 -
2022你不容错过的软件测试项目实战(APP项目实战)免费版
前言最近很多的人都在问我有没有什么项目可以用来练手,正好我这里有一个比较适合练手的项目,那就给大家安利一下吧,废话就不多说了。项目名称:APP项目实战项目说明:本项目里面包括了功能测试、性能测试、安全性测试、界面、易用、兼容性测试、稳定性测试、冒烟测试。内容都在图里了大家看图!获取方式鉴于篇幅所限,需要的朋友可以私信“项目”获取!比心哟...原创 2022-05-10 21:41:37 · 3132 阅读 · 85 评论 -
七叔带你玩转pytest—fixture,妈妈再也不用担心学不会测试了
前言我们今天呢来看看pytest实现fixture有几种方式,分别该怎么进行呢?小编废话不多说了咱们直接开始吧!自动化测试框架中的 fixture我们在编写测试用例,都会涉及到用例执行之前的环境准备工作,和用例执行之后的环境清理工作。代码版的测试用例也不例外。在自动化测试框架当中,我们也需要编写:用例执行之前的环境准备工作代码(前置工作代码)用例执行之后的环境清理工作(后置工作代码)通常,在自动化测试框架当中,都叫做 fixture。pytest 作为 py.原创 2022-05-08 16:19:32 · 558 阅读 · 0 评论 -
csdn—三分钟带你学会APP 自动化测试 —多设备并发 -appium+pytest+ 多线程
前言七叔今天想和大家分享一下关于app 自动化测试的一个内容,那就是多设备并发 -appium+pytest+ 多线程,七叔也不多说废话了,咱们直接开始走流程吧。要是觉得还不错的请关注七叔哟。1、appium+python 实现单设备的 app 自动化测试启动 appium server,占用端口 4723 电脑与一个设备连接,通过 adb devices 获取已连接的设备 在 python 代码当中,编写启动参数,通过 pytest 编写测试用例,来进行自动化测试。2、若要.原创 2022-05-07 16:47:39 · 878 阅读 · 1 评论 -
全网最新最全的unittest单元测试的定义
目录单元测试的定义1. 什么是单元测试?2.为什么要做单元测试?unittest框架及原理unittest的断言TestCase测试用例TestFixure测试夹具TestSuite测试套件TestRunner执行用例单元测试的定义1. 什么是单元测试? 单元测试是指,对软件中的最小可测试单元在与程序其他部分相隔离的情况下进行检查和验证的工作,这里的最小可测试单元通常是指函数或者类,一般是开发来做的,按照测试阶段来分,就是单元测试、集成测试、系统测试以及原创 2021-12-14 21:25:52 · 445 阅读 · 0 评论 -
这篇文章教会你Python自动化测试需要学什么?怎么去学?从哪里开始学?看完本文学习python目标明确,学习简单粗暴。
一、Python常用领域Python用于简单脚本编程,如编写2048小游戏或12306的自动抢票软件; Python用于系统编程,如开发系统应用; Python用于开发网络爬虫; 网络爬虫的用途是进行数据采集,也就是将互联网中的数据采集过来。网络爬虫的难点其实并不在于爬虫本身,由于网站方为了避免被爬取回采取各种各样的反爬虫措施,而如果想要继续从网站爬取数据就需要解决这些反爬虫措施,所以网络爬虫的难点在于反爬的攻克和处理。 Python用于Web开发,如个人博客、在线教育网站以及论坛等; P原创 2021-12-13 19:14:59 · 1110 阅读 · 2 评论